I have read that a lot of people use the Purigen Filters in their nano tanks.

My question is where exactly do I put it - My tank is un-modded and the chambers are as below:

1 - Regular Oceanic 8 filter, Heater
2 - Floss at the bottom, Live rock rubble (thinking of changing because water level is never very high.
3 - return pump

Take he liverock rubble out. It is a detritus trap and will result in nitrates down the road.

Try Floss first chamber.
Purigen at the beginning of 2nd chamber and chemipure elite at the end of 2nd chamber.
Heater in last chamber with return pump.

Purigen breaks down the organic waste and then the chemipure elite removes resulting nitrates so I would make sense for purigen to come first.

Generally, the water heights in the chambers should be different because it is indicating the controlled flow happening back there. It is pouring from one chamber to the next. You can probably fill a little more if it does not affect this.

A lot of times, stock filter pads are just poly floss with carbon inside. The chemipure is carbon among other things. Maybe you can put purigen underneath polyfloss in the first chamber and chemipure elite in the second chamber.
